Top Sri Kumar Medicals | Reviews & Ratings | comparemela.com

Sri kumar medicals in India - 570023/ near mysuru

Sri kumar medicals in India - 628008/ near thoothukudi

Sri kumar medicals in India - 625009/ near madurai

Sri kumar medicals in India - 600118/ near chennai